Output 271df28ff718a73542117e0f28d9906f85b2cfeaf2384b90450cbd1a6acd40a4:2

value
515322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ddd48f76f26ed0c674912bf7d9ae6149a01128 OP_EQUAL
address
2NABzjp7E5erUXtdjSBRjwCTxCwDgZGuAoE
transaction
271df28ff718a73542117e0f28d9906f85b2cfeaf2384b90450cbd1a6acd40a4
confirmations
103349
spent
true